刪除舊的 Ubuntu 4.x 核心是否安全?

刪除舊的 Ubuntu 4.x 核心是否安全?

我正在運行 Ubuntu 18.04 x86_64,已使用dist-upgrade.我有一個舊內核,我不確定刪除它是否安全:

$ ls /boot/
config-4.15.0-64-generic      memtest86+.elf
config-5.0.0-29-generic       memtest86+_multiboot.bin
efi                           System.map-4.15.0-64-generic
grub                          System.map-5.0.0-29-generic
initrd.img-4.15.0-64-generic  vmlinuz-4.15.0-64-generic
initrd.img-5.0.0-29-generic   vmlinuz-5.0.0-29-generic
memtest86+.bin

我還使用 Nvidia 和 Virtual Box DKMS/usr/lib作為核心。我曾經dkms remove ...刪除過 4.x 模組,但它們不斷返回:

$ ls /lib/modules/
4.15.0-64-generic  5.0.0-29-generic

$ dkms status
nvidia, 430.26, 4.15.0-64-generic, x86_64: installed
nvidia, 430.26, 5.0.0-29-generic, x86_64: installed
virtualbox, 5.2.32, 4.15.0-64-generic, x86_64: installed
virtualbox, 5.2.32, 5.0.0-29-generic, x86_64: installed

我發現隨機崩潰,我相信它們是由於視訊驅動程式造成的。每次啟動和每次登入都會產生崩潰報告(不是恐慌)。 Nouveau(通用 X 驅動程式)和 Nvidia (nvidia-driver-430) 都會發生崩潰。不幸的是,Ubuntu 沒有提供詳細資訊。我只能選擇“取消”或“發送”(而不是“查看”)。

我想刪除舊內核以希望解決該問題。問題是,上次我厭倦了在打開 SecureBoot 並簽署核心的情況下執行此操作,機器停止了啟動。

我的問題是,在此配置中刪除舊的 Ubuntu 4.x 核心是否安全?

答案1

你唯一的內核需要是您要啟動的。舊核心甚至新核心始終可以安全刪除。

相關內容